Pathé Ciss vs. Rayo Vallecano: The Standoff Explained Simply

Imagine you have a favorite toy you’ve played with for years. You’re ready for a new toy, but the toy store says, "Nope, you have to pay a huge fee to return it!" That’s basically what’s happening between soccer player Pathé Ciss and his club, Rayo Vallecano.


What Happened on Monday?

Pathé Ciss said "No" to practice.

  • He showed up at the training ground but refused to train with his teammates.
  • Why? He wants to leave the club right now.
  • He feels his time in Vallecas (Rayo’s neighborhood) is finished.
  • He’s told the club this many times before.

Important Point: This isn’t a sudden tantrum. It’s the latest chapter in a long story.


Who Wants to Sign Him?

Several clubs have knocked on the door this summer:

Club Country Extra Info
Mystery Spanish Club Spain Plays in European competition this season (like Champions League or Europa League)
Beşiktaş Turkey Big, historic club in Istanbul
Al Shabab Saudi Arabia Rich club in the Saudi Pro League

Ciss thinks it’s time for a new adventure away from Rayo.


Rayo’s Response: "Pay Up or He Stays"

Rayo Vallecano is standing firm. Here’s their position:

  • Contract: Runs until 2027 (one year left after this season).
  • Release Clause: €10 million (about $10.8 million USD).
  • Message to buyers: "Pay the €10M clause, or he’s not going anywhere."

They don’t want to lose one of their most used players from recent years unless the money is right.


A Long History of "Almost Left"

This has been going on for years. Here’s the timeline:

1. January 2023 – The Big One: Lyon

  • Ciss had everything agreed to join Olympique Lyon (France).
  • Rayo blocked the move at the last second.

2. Other Clubs Who Tried (and Failed)

Over the years, these clubs showed interest but Rayo said no:

  • Spain: Valencia, Celta Vigo, Real Valladolid, Girona
  • France: Metz, Lens
  • Germany: Stuttgart
  • Turkey: Adana Demirspor
  • Qatar: Al Arabi
  • Saudi Arabia: Al Shabab (tried last summer too)

3. 2024 – The Secret Contract Trick

  • Ciss renewed his contract in 2024 (club never announced it!).
  • Why? To lower his release clause from €50M → €10M.
  • The deal: "I’ll sign a new deal to make it cheaper for you to sell me, but you must let me go if €10M comes in."
  • Result: No one paid the €10M. Rayo kept him anyway.

Callout: The player tried to help the club get money for him (he’d be free in 2025 otherwise), but the club still said no to every offer.


Why Does Rayo Want to Keep Him So Badly?

Because he’s been their rock since 2021.

  • 179 official games in a Rayo shirt.
  • Key player for multiple coaches.
  • Super versatile: Played midfield, defense, even center-back in emergencies!
  • Physical, reliable, competitive – the kind of player every team loves.

But now, he’s worn out. He feels he’s given everything and his chapter is closed.


Where Things Stand Now

The Standoff:

  1. Ciss: "I’m not training until you let me leave."
  2. Rayo: "Clause is €10M. Pay it or he stays."
  3. Interested Clubs: Must decide in the next few days if they’ll pay.

The ball is in the buyers’ court.

FAQ

1. What is a "release clause"?

It’s a set price in a player’s contract. If another club pays that exact amount, the player can leave – the current club cannot stop it. It’s like a "Buy Now" price tag.

2. Why did Ciss renew in 2024 if he wanted to leave?

Smart move! His old clause was €50M (impossible to pay). By renewing, he got it dropped to €10M – a realistic fee. He did it to help Rayo get money, since he’d leave for free in 2025 anyway.

3. Can Rayo legally fine him for not training?

Yes. Clubs can fine players for "unexcused absence" from training. But this is a pressure tactic – Ciss is betting the club will prefer cash over a unhappy player.

4. What happens if no one pays €10M?

Ciss stays at Rayo until January (winter window) or next summer (when his contract has 1 year left and his value drops). Risky for both sides.
